Block walls serve both practical and visual functions in landscaping, offering structure, personal privacy, and visual interest to outdoor spaces. These walls can be utilized to keep soil on sloped residential or commercial properties, specify garden beds, or develop clear boundaries within a landscape. The choice of block type-- concrete, interlocking, or ornamental-- affects both the strength and look of the wall. Correct planning guarantees stability, particularly for taller walls, with considerations for drain, support, and soil pressure. Installation begins with a well-prepared base, typically including excavation and leveling to guarantee the wall stays straight and stable with time. Mortar or adhesive may be utilized depending upon the block type, and support like rebar can improve resilience. A skilled landscaper ensures each course is level and lined up, avoiding future moving or cracking. Block walls likewise provide innovative chances through surfaces, textures, and colors, permitting them to complement the surrounding landscape. Integrating lighting, planters, or cascading plants can soften the difficult edges, making the wall both useful and aesthetically enticing. Regular examinations and minor repairs assist keep the wall's integrity for years to come
